Advantages of Replacing Windows and Doors
Energy Efficiency: New doors and windows are typically developed with sophisticated innovations that improve insulation. This minimizes cooling and heating costs significantly.
Boosted Security: Modern materials and locking mechanisms enhance the security of a home, hindering potential break-ins.
Increased Aesthetic Appeal: Updated windows and doors can drastically enhance the appearance of a home, making it more attractive both in and out.
Increased Home Value: Replacing old windows and doors can increase the general resale value of a property, attracting possible buyers.
Sound Reduction: Quality replacements can lessen outside sound, adding to a more tranquil living environment.
UV Protection: Many contemporary windows come with UV-blocking functions that secure furniture and flooring from fading due to sun direct exposure.

1. How do I know if I require to change my windows or doors?Signs consist of drafts, condensation, decomposing materials, cracked glass, or trouble opening and closing.
2. What is the typical expense of doors and window replacements?Expenses can vary widely based upon products, labor, and the scope of work, however generally vary from ₤ 300 to over ₤ 1,000 per system.
3. For how long does the installation process take?Installation can generally be finished in one to two days, depending upon the variety of doors and windows being changed.
4. Are replacement windows energy-efficient?Many modern windows are developed with energy-efficiency in mind, featuring Low-E glass and insulation techniques that can considerably minimize energy costs.
5. Can I set up windows or doors myself?While some house owners might choose for DIY setups, professional installation is suggested to guarantee proper fitting and weatherproofing.
